当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

对象存储的速度取决于,深度解析,对象存储速度的决定因素及优化策略

对象存储的速度取决于,深度解析,对象存储速度的决定因素及优化策略

对象存储速度受多个因素影响,包括存储架构、网络带宽、数据处理能力等。深度解析表明,优化策略包括提升存储节点性能、优化数据访问路径、采用分布式存储技术等,以提高对象存储速...

对象存储速度受多个因素影响,包括存储架构、网络带宽、数据处理能力等。深度解析表明,优化策略包括提升存储节点性能、优化数据访问路径、采用分布式存储技术等,以提高对象存储速度。

随着大数据时代的到来,数据存储需求日益增长,对象存储作为新型存储技术,凭借其海量存储、高并发、低成本等优势,在众多领域得到了广泛应用,在实际应用中,用户对对象存储速度的要求越来越高,如何提高对象存储速度成为众多企业和开发者关注的焦点,本文将深入分析对象存储速度的决定因素,并提出相应的优化策略。

对象存储速度的决定因素

1、硬件设备性能

(1)存储介质:对象存储的存储介质主要有硬盘、固态硬盘(SSD)和混合硬盘(HDD+SSD)等,SSD的读写速度远高于HDD,因此使用SSD作为存储介质可以有效提高对象存储速度。

对象存储的速度取决于,深度解析,对象存储速度的决定因素及优化策略

(2)网络设备:网络设备包括交换机、路由器等,高速、稳定的网络设备可以保证数据传输的实时性和可靠性,从而提高对象存储速度。

2、软件系统性能

(1)文件系统:文件系统负责存储、管理数据,其性能直接影响对象存储速度,常见的文件系统有EXT4、XFS等,它们在性能上存在差异,应根据实际需求选择合适的文件系统。

(2)存储引擎:存储引擎负责处理数据的读写请求,常见的存储引擎有Ceph、GlusterFS等,不同存储引擎的性能特点不同,应根据应用场景选择合适的存储引擎。

3、存储架构

(1)分布式存储:分布式存储通过将数据分散存储在多个节点上,可以提高数据读写速度和系统可靠性,常见的分布式存储架构有Ceph、HDFS等。

(2)多级缓存:多级缓存可以将频繁访问的数据存储在内存中,从而提高对象存储速度,常见的多级缓存策略有LRU(最近最少使用)、LRUC(最近最少使用+缓存容量限制)等。

4、数据传输协议

(1)HTTP/HTTPS:HTTP/HTTPS协议广泛应用于对象存储,但其传输速度相对较慢,采用更高效的传输协议,如Rsync、iSCSI等,可以提高数据传输速度。

(2)多线程传输:多线程传输可以同时进行多个数据传输任务,从而提高数据传输效率。

对象存储的速度取决于,深度解析,对象存储速度的决定因素及优化策略

对象存储速度优化策略

1、选择高性能硬件设备

(1)存储介质:优先选择SSD作为存储介质,提高数据读写速度。

(2)网络设备:选择高速、稳定的网络设备,如10Gbps、40Gbps交换机等。

2、优化软件系统性能

(1)选择合适的文件系统:根据实际需求选择性能优良的文件系统。

(2)优化存储引擎:针对不同应用场景,选择合适的存储引擎。

3、优化存储架构

(1)采用分布式存储:将数据分散存储在多个节点上,提高数据读写速度和系统可靠性。

(2)引入多级缓存:将频繁访问的数据存储在内存中,提高对象存储速度。

4、优化数据传输协议

对象存储的速度取决于,深度解析,对象存储速度的决定因素及优化策略

(1)采用高效传输协议:如Rsync、iSCSI等,提高数据传输速度。

(2)多线程传输:实现多线程数据传输,提高数据传输效率。

5、定期维护和优化

(1)定期检查硬件设备性能,确保其正常运行。

(2)定期检查软件系统性能,及时修复故障。

(3)定期清理缓存,提高缓存命中率。

对象存储速度对实际应用至关重要,通过分析对象存储速度的决定因素,并采取相应的优化策略,可以有效提高对象存储速度,满足用户需求,在实际应用中,应根据具体场景选择合适的硬件设备、软件系统、存储架构和数据传输协议,以达到最佳的性能表现。

黑狐家游戏

发表评论

最新文章